Mastering SaaS Retention: Logo Churn vs. Net Revenue Churn

Customer and revenue churn are the ultimate growth limiters for subscription and SaaS businesses. While logo churn tracks the percentage of individual accounts that cancel, Net Revenue Churn incorporates contraction, cancellations, and the power of existing customer upgrades (expansion MRR). Negative net churn—where expansion exceeds churn—powers the fastest growing public and private SaaS companies.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the formula for customer (logo) churn rate?

Customer Churn Rate (%) = (Customers Lost during period / Total Customers at start of period) x 100.

What is Net Revenue Churn?

Net Revenue Churn (%) = [(Churned MRR + Contraction MRR - Expansion MRR) / Starting MRR] x 100. When Expansion MRR is greater than churned and contracted revenue, Net Revenue Churn becomes negative, which is an indicator of top-tier SaaS performance.

What is considered a healthy churn rate for SaaS?

For SMB SaaS targeting small businesses, 3% to 5% monthly churn is common. For Mid-Market SaaS ($10k-$50k ACV), healthy monthly churn is 1% to 2%. For Enterprise SaaS ($100k+ ACV), top companies achieve under 0.5% monthly churn (or under 6% annually).

How does churn rate affect Customer Lifetime Value (LTV)?

LTV is inversely related to churn rate: Average Customer Lifetime = 1 / Churn Rate. For example, a 5% monthly churn rate means the average customer stays for 20 months (1 / 0.05). Halving churn to 2.5% doubles average customer lifetime to 40 months.
